The Department
The Modern Foreign Languages department teaches French. Facilities include well-equipped classrooms, and a dedicated space for one-to-one and small-group tuition. All students are taught French from years 7 to 9, developing the basic skills of language learning. In year 9, pupils choose whether to continue with French GCSE.
We had been successful in retaining high numbers of students in Year 10 and Year 11. Our results have been good, with many students exceeding their national expectations. We provide opportunities for students to experience languages and life beyond the curriculum, such as links with local universities and our partner school, film days, national competitions, and a residential trip to France.
